How the formula works
Both dram per cup and dram per liter measure the same physical quantity (mass per unit volume), so converting between them is a single multiplication. Multiply a value in dram per cup by 4.226753 to get dram per liter. To reverse the conversion, multiply a dram per liter value by 0.236588 to get back to dram per cup.
